Rear Projection

When you select Rear Projection, the projector reverses the image so you can project from behind a translucent screen.

Default Source

Default Source toggles between Computer and Video. This deter- mines which source the projector checks first during power-up for active video. Click the button to toggle between the options.

Auto Source Select

This setting toggles between On and Off. When this feature is Off, the projector defaults to the source selected in Default Source. To display another source, you must manually select one by press- ing the computer or video button on the keypad. When this fea- ture is On, the projector automatically finds the active source, checking the default source first. Click the button to toggle between the options.
